Subject: Re: 32-bit powerpc, aty128fb: vmap allocation for size 135168 failed

On Aug 18 2017, Meelis Roos <mroos@...ux.ee> wrote:

> Aug 17 23:53:57 pohl kernel: [ 2940.146546] aty128fb 0000:00:10.0: Invalid PCI ROM header signature: expecting 0xaa55, got 0x1111
> Aug 17 23:54:02 pohl kernel: [ 2944.804838] aty128fb 0000:00:10.0: Invalid PCI ROM header signature: expecting 0xaa55, got 0x1110

I think these messages are harmless and expected.  This device has no
x86 option ROM but a OpenFirmware one.  This is likely unrelated to the
sddm crash.
